Abstract
The energy level shift of the atom coupled with both vacuum electromagnetic field and a driving laser is studied by using a unitary transformation approach, which directly includes the effect of the counter-rotating terms of the interaction between the atom and the vacuum field. The Lamb shift of the energy levels is shown to depend on the Rabi frequency and the detuning of the driving laser which couples another two levels. This relation provides a way to control the Lamb shift coherently.
